Hyderabad, April 10 -- Telangana Director General of Police (DGP) B. Shivadhar Reddy on Friday said the state government will soon issue health cards to all surrendered Maoists, with no cap on treatment expenditure, as part of its rehabilitation measures.

Speaking to reporters after the surrender of 42 underground Maoist cadres before Telangana Police, the DGP said the government would issue a Government Order in the next few days formalising the health card scheme.

He said the benefit would be extended to all Maoist cadres who surrendered in Telangana between 2024 and 2026, irrespective of their native place, in line with an earlier assurance given by Chief Minister A. Revanth Reddy.
